Marinated Cucumbers, Onions, and Tomatoes

Ingredients

Scale
  • 2 cups cucumbers (sliced thin)
  • 1 small red onion (thinly sliced)
  • 1 cup cherry tomatoes (halved)
  • 1/4 cup white wine vinegar
  • 2 tablespoons extra virgin olive oil
  • Salt and pepper to taste

Instructions

  1. Wash all vegetables thoroughly. Slice cucumbers and red onion; halve cherry tomatoes.
  2. In a large bowl, whisk together vinegar, olive oil, salt, and pepper until well combined.
  3. Add the sliced cucumbers, onions, and cherry tomatoes to the bowl. Toss gently until fully coated in the marinade.
  4. Cover with plastic wrap or transfer to an airtight container. Refrigerate for at least one hour to marinate.
  5. Serve chilled or at room temperature.
